may 8, 2014 - Employers don't have to cover birth control

Description:

In Burwell v. Hobby Lobby, the Supreme Court ruled that for-profit companies don’t have to cover birth control in their health insurance plans if they cite religious objections.

This overturned the birth control mandate in the Affordable Care Act and put many women at risk of not being able to afford birth control coverage.
